Sir, Ive studied bio-science in classes 11 and 12. Can I study engineering after class 12.....

shailaja chowdhury 21st Jun, 2019

Hello Sajid!

You can study engineering if you have taken up Physics, chemistry and mathematics. It doesnt matter if you have studied biology or not. The competitive exams will only test your knowledge of the subjects physics, chemistry and mathematics.
